--- Comment #5 from Tor Lillqvist <[email protected]> ---
Further investigation seems to show that there are problems both when using
"glyph caching" and not (SAL_DISABLE_GLYPH_CACHING=1), and when using OpenGL
and not. Different problems, though. In one case the ₂ shows up just fine
(being picked through glyph replacement from another font), in the other case
it doesn't show up and instead you get a mis-rendered mess with two small black
boxes. In both cases the glyph widths as used by cursor movement don't match
the actually rendered glyphs. In short, a sorry mess. Sigh.
